Cómo preparar Barbecued Baby Back Ribs

  1. Trim excess fat from the ribs, leaving a thin layer for moisture.
  2. In a medium bowl, combine 2 tablespoons paprika, 1 tablespoon garlic salt, 1 tablespoon onion powder, 1 teaspoon dried sage, 1 teaspoon celery seeds, and 1/2 teaspoon cayenne pepper.
  3. Stir the dry rub ingredients until thoroughly combined.
  4. Generously sprinkle the rub mixture evenly over both sides of the ribs, pressing gently to adhere.
  5. Use your fingers to rub the spice mixture into the meat.
  6. Prepare your grill for indirect grilling. Ensure you have a drip pan positioned beneath the ribs.
  7. Maintain a medium heat (approximately 300-350°F).
  8. Place the ribs bone-side down on the grill rack directly over the drip pan.
  9. Cover the grill and cook for 1 hour 15 minutes to 1 hour 45 minutes, or until the ribs are tender and easily pull apart. After 45 minutes of cooking, begin brushing the ribs with apple juice every 15 minutes to maintain moisture and add sweetness.
  10. Once cooked, remove ribs from grill, let rest for 10 minutes before serving. Enjoy!
